Linux基础——常用命令(三)

<1> find  —— find命令功能非常强大,通常用来在特定的目录下搜索符合条件的文件,也可以用来搜索特定用户属主的文件。

可以看到有01文件夹原先有以下文件

Linux基础——常用命令(三)_第1张图片

find+文件名      例如:find  test.txt    查找名为test.txt的文件

Linux基础——常用命令(三)_第2张图片

find   *.txt     查找后缀为.txt的文件

Linux基础——常用命令(三)_第3张图片

find -size +4K -size -5M       查找文件大于4K小于5M的文件

find  -size    5M                        查找等于5M的文件

find  -size  +5M                       查找大于5M的文件

find -size   -5M                        查找小于5M的文件

<2>  ln    文件链接  分为软链接  、硬链接

ln   源文件   链接文件               硬链接

ln -s    源文件  链接文件           软链接

硬链接与软链接的区别:

硬链接 源文件删除 链接文件还是存在

软链接 源链接删除 链接文件失效

注意:如果软链接文件和源文件不在同一个目录,源文件要使用绝对路径,不能使用相对路径。

<3>  绝对路径和相对路径

相对路径 在输入路径时,最前面不是 / 或者 ~,表示相对 当前目录 所在的目录位置

绝对路径 在输入路径时,最前面是 / 或者 ~,表示从 根目录/家目录 开始的具体目录位置

Linux基础——常用命令(三)_第4张图片
Linux基础——常用命令(三)_第5张图片

<4>归档、解档,归档压缩、解档压缩

-cvf     归档                        tar -cvf    打包文件   文件

-xvf     解档                        tar -xvf    打包文件   文件

-zcvf   归档并压缩             tar -zcvf   打包文件.gz   文件

-zxvf   解档并压缩             tar -zxvf   打包文件.gz   文件

Linux基础——常用命令(三)_第6张图片

另附一张图(Linux常用命令一、二、三)Xmind图

你可能感兴趣的:(Linux基础——常用命令(三))